YVR 2 — specification and verdict
YVR 2 traded resolution for thickness: pancake optics and a 350 g body, but only 1600x1600 per eye across a 95-degree diagonal field at 90 Hz. That is fine for spatial tasks — walking a scene, picking up a tool, following a hand gesture demonstrated by an instructor — and poor for reading. Procedure text, MSDS labels and small gauge markings on a machine model have to be authored oversized or the trainee leans in to read them, which is exactly the behaviour that breaks a timed exercise. The Snapdragon XR2 Gen 1 with 8 GB of RAM will drive a course scene, and 128 or 256 GB is enough storage for a library of them. Note that the YVR 2 has no documented controller-free hand tracking, so every interaction goes through the two bundled 6DoF YVR Controllers.
There is no vendor MDM and no kiosk mode we could find, so a fleet of these is managed headset by headset, by hand, at the end of every training day. The 5300 mAh battery gives about 2.5 hours, which covers a morning session but not a full day without a charging break, and the pack is not hot-swappable. The facial interface is a separate foam part that comes off for wiping between trainees, which is the one genuinely fleet-friendly thing about the design. Play For Dream sells the headset directly at 399.99 USD, but there is no Polish or German distributor, no local RMA path and no enterprise licensing offer — a broken unit goes back to the vendor, not to a reseller down the road.
Do not buy this for a training fleet. It is a 2022 XR2 Gen 1 headset whose maker has since renamed itself Play For Dream and moved its engineering to a much newer device, and our courses have no supported deployment path onto the YVR platform. If the pancake form factor and the 350 g weight are what attracted you, look at a current Android standalone with vendor device management instead.

Who this device is for
This is for someone who wants to hold an early mass-produced pancake headset — a hardware researcher, an optics course, a museum of form factors. It is not for a safety training operator: no fleet management, no local support in the EU, and a resolution that undercuts even its own predecessor the YVR 1.
What is missing, and what the manufacturer does not publish
YVR never published a spec sheet we could still reach: yvrdream.com now redirects to a 404 on the Play For Dream domain, and the surviving store page lists a price and nothing else. So there is no first-party figure for IPD adjustment range, brightness, Wi-Fi generation, Bluetooth version, dimensions or charge time, and no stated end-of-support date for the YVR platform. Passthrough is recorded as grayscale because the only description available says it runs off the tracking cameras; nobody publishes a passthrough resolution or frame rate.
YVR 2 — frequently asked questions
- Is the YVR 2 still sold now that YVR renamed itself Play For Dream?
- Yes. Play For Dream still lists the YVR 2 on its own store at 399.99 USD, well under the 750 USD it launched at in July 2022. The company's current engineering effort is its newer Play For Dream MR headset, so treat the YVR 2 as inventory being sold down rather than a product with a roadmap.
- Can Skillsive VR safety courses be deployed on a fleet of YVR 2 headsets?
- No. The YVR 2 runs Android on a YVR-operated platform with no vendor MDM or kiosk mode that we could verify, so there is no supported way to push a course to twenty headsets or lock them to a single app. Our courses are marked as not running on it; pick an Android standalone with real device management if you need a fleet.
- Is 1600x1600 per eye enough to read procedure text in the YVR 2?
- Only if the text is authored large. 1600x1600 per eye over a 95-degree diagonal field is a step down from the 2160x2160 of the earlier YVR 1, and small labels, gauge scales and dense instruction panels lose legibility. Scenes built around movement and object handling hold up much better than scenes built around reading.
